Antique French Savonnerie Carpet (fragment)
Size: 8'7" × 11'9" (261 × 358 cm)
This elegant 19th-century French Savonnerie carpet, dating from circa 1820, is a remarkable example of refined European craftsmanship, presenting a botanical theme infused with classical French design sensibilities. Handwoven with extraordinary precision, this antique rug is framed by a decorative border of stylized floral medallions in rose and blue cartouches, lending a sense of structure and grandeur to the flowing, naturalistic interior.
The field of the carpet features a luxuriant cascade of vibrant flowers, rendered in a painterly palette of coral, blush pink, cornflower blue, and verdant greens. Twisting golden acanthus scrolls emerge from four corners, framing woven baskets overflowing with lush floral arrangements—an emblematic motif of the Savonnerie tradition. These elaborate arabesques form cartouche-like enclosures that evoke neoclassical elegance and anchor the otherwise free-flowing floral background.
Despite its age, the carpet retains an impressive clarity of design and coloration. The graceful interplay between architectural structure and organic flourishes is typical of early 19th-century French decorative arts, where royal commissions and aristocratic interiors demanded a synthesis of opulence and taste.
Woven during the post-Napoleonic period, this Savonnerie rug likely once adorned a grand salon or formal reception room, reflecting the affluence and aesthetic refinement of its original setting. It stands as a testament to the enduring artistry of the French Savonnerie workshops, founded in the 17th century under royal patronage.
